
MP Vijitha Herath stated that the upcoming local government election must be viewed as a public referendum where the people will express their views on the frauds and crimes committed by the government.
Speaking to the media at a press conference yesterday (2), MP Herath stated that the government is conducting these elections with utmost reluctance.
He further stated that the elections will be treated as an expression of public opinion where the people will decide upon the fate of a government that committed crimes just as much as the Rajapaksa regime.
When questioned on the decision of the Bond Commission to summon Prime Minister Ranil Wickremesinghe to submit evidence on the ongoing bond scandal, Vijitha Herath stated that the Prime Minister should have appeared before the Commission before being summoned to display his innocence.
